Why we recommend this

Roopkund introduces expedition logistics with a lower-risk progression curve, making it the safer first expedition for most trekkers. Junglam demands a significantly steeper physical toll.

  • Safer, more predictable progression path
  • Significantly lower altitude burden and hypoxia risk
  • Requires less sustained trail endurance (shorter duration)
  • Optimal benchmark for first-time or transitioning aspirants

Alternative Pick

Junglam

Choose instead if...

  • Maximum high-altitude exposure is your absolute priority
  • You have proven, recent acclimatization confidence above 15,000ft
  • You already have strong technical or multi-day expedition experience

Roopkund · Hardest Day

Visit Skeleton Lake & Return

Why Trekkers Struggle

Most trekkers fail on Roopkund because the route compresses a massive amount of altitude gain into a short window. Even fit climbers often begin experiencing acute hypoxia symptoms before their bodies can properly adapt.

Best Suited For

Aspirants with a proven track record on fast-ascent, high-altitude profiles.

Planning & Logistics

Medical Access & Risk

Roopkund Trek provides a higher level of safety infrastructure, specifically noting oxygen refill capabilities at basecamp which Junglam Trek lacks.

Better for: Roopkund

Atmosphere & Isolation

Junglam is known for being absolute, intimidating wilderness isolation., while Roopkund is moderate.

Personal Preference

Gear Rental

Roopkund Trek has gear rental available (Lohajung) — useful if you're not travelling with full kit. Junglam Trek has no rental option at base; bring all equipment from a city like Rishikesh or Manali.

Better for: Roopkund
